Hand painted Cards Help Support Art Therapy for Iraqi Children Imagine being a child in Iraq. Fear of attacks and bombings are a daily grim reality. Adults are extremely frustrated with so many things-the lack of security and jobs, extremely high cost of living, breakdowns of infrastructure-no electricity, no water. The list goes on. When adults find it increasingly difficult to cope, children suffer too. Now, imagine having to leave what is left of your home and travel to a different country where you are a refugee with whoever is left from your family. These are the children served by the Webdah School and Family Center in Jordan. (more...) 2005 North Pacific Yearly Meeting The North Pacific Yearly Meeting of the Religious Society of Friends (Quakers), standing in the 350 year tradition of Friends’ opposition to war, calls for the immediate, orderly termination of the military occupation of Iraq by the United States. We believe we are called to live in that love and power that takes away the occasion of all war. (more...)
